What is an MXF file?

MXF files mostly belong to Premiere Pro by Adobe. MXF files are usually media container files used to store video and audio content in Material Exchange Format. Such MXF videos are mainly used to deliver advertisements to TV stations and for tapeless archiving of TV programs. An MXF file may also contain rich metadata, captions, and subtitles. The metadata stored in an MXF container may include video frame rate, timestamps, frame size, and custom data. MXF format supports various video and audio codecs. It is used to streamline multimedia asset sharing and media support between recording, editing, and broadcasting formats. Some Canon and Sony digital camcorders store videos in MXF format. Such videos are playable/editable with programs such as QuickTime, Media Composer, and Premiere Pro. MXF filename extension is also associated with font files used in some editions of SimCity, a building strategy video game. Picasa, a video and image management software also saves movie projects in MXF files.

  2. MX Editor (remote control data) by URC
    MX Editor is a program used to edit the settings and channel list of Universal Remote Controllers such as the MX-700 and MX-800. Remote control data created with MX Editior is stored in MXF files. This program appears to have been discontinued. This file format is classified as Data.
  3. SimCity (game fonts) by Electronic Arts
    SimCity is a series of city-building strategy video games available for desktop, mobile, console, and handheld devices. Fonts used to render texts in the game are stored in MXF (Maxis font) files. This file format is classified as Font.
  4. VLC (video) by VideoLAN
    VLC is an open-source cross-platform multimedia player and file conversion software. It supports the playback of various multimedia formats such as MXF, MP4, MVM and M2TS. This file format is classified as Video. Related links: Material Exchange Format, About Pro Video Formats
